Key applications today are dominated by electric vehicles (traction inverters and on-board charging), fast chargers, renewable-energy inverters, data-center and telecom power supplies, and industrial drives—areas that benefit most from SiC’s efficiency and thermal advantages and where system-level cost and efficiency tradeoffs favor SiC adoption.The SiC ecosystem (value chain) spans upstream raw-material and substrate suppliers (bulk SiC crystal growers and wafer makers), epitaxial (epi) wafer manufacturers, device fabs (front-end processing), power-module and packaging specialists, test & qualification services, and downstream system integrators/OEMs (automotive Tier-1s, inverter makers, datacenter PSU vendors). Upstream concentration and capacity (substrates/epi) are strategic bottlenecks that determine cost and yield; midstream device makers add process IP (implantation, gate technology, trench or planar MOS structures) and qualification for automotive AEC-Q/TS standards; downstream players drive integration into modules and cooling/thermal management solutions. Leading device suppliers include STMicroelectronics, Infineon, Wolfspeed (Cree), ROHM, onsemi, Toshiba/Mitsubishi and several Chinese and Japanese challengers—competition has intensified as these players scale 150–200 mm wafer flows and pursue module partnerships. Industry developments to watch: widescale migration to 200 mm SiC manufacturing to lower unit cost (major vendors announced 200 mm roadmaps), consolidation and verticalization (some substrate and epi play acquisitions/alliances), push for higher reliability and automotive qualification, and system-level optimization (SiC + Si hybrid topologies, smarter packaging and cooling). Market forecasts show multi-year double-digit CAGR as SiC penetration grows in EV traction and renewables, even as supply and short-term demand cycles create volatility for specific producers.
